What Is The Best Way To Control Weeds In A Flower Bed. Start by digging out any single weeds that may be in the bed spaces. The first step to combat weeds in your flower bed is to prepare the area before you plant by clearing as much grass or growth off the soil surface. Protect the soil from sunlight. One of the best types for maneuvering in tight spaces between plants in your flower bed is a lightweight scuffle hoe (the blade can wiggle back and forth rather than remain stationary). A hoe lets you dispatch many small weeds quickly without having to crouch or kneel. How to prevent weeds in flower beds. You could alternatively hoe but make sure you don’t hoe deeply or you could end up with more weeds. Use a scuffle hoe to weed while standing up.
